Most reported results about phase transition probed by the photoluminescence (PL) spectra of Eu3+ ions are qualitative, but the quantitative analyses of phase transition were presented in this work. We fabricated (Na0.8, K0.2)0.5Bi0.497Eu0.003TiO3 (NKBT20:Eu) ferroelectric ceramics and investigated the phase structures and the PL spectra of NKBT20:Eu ceramics before and after poling at different electric fields. The PL spectra indicate a phase transition from tetragonal phase (T phase) to rhombohedral phase (R phase) within NKBT20:Eu ceramics after poling, consistent with the analyses by X‐ray diffraction (XRD). Moreover, the emission intensity ratios of the “hypersensitive” transition to the magnetic dipole transition could be used to calculate the fractions of the phase transition quantitatively, which were further confirmed by XRD Rietveld refinements. This study provides a different perspective to investigate the phase transition induced by electric field for NKBT20:Eu ceramics, qualitatively and quantitatively, and the method is expected to be useful in more cases of phase analyses.
